- 1 cup of un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 cup of granulated sugar
- 1 cup of water
- 1 cup of heavy cream
- 1 cup of vodka or rum (pick your favorite!)
- 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ract
Step 1: Cocoa InfusionIn a medium saucepan, combine the unsweetened cocoa powder and granulated sugar.Gradually add water while whisking the mixture until it forms a smooth, lump-free paste.Place the saucepan over medium heat and bring the mixture to a gentle boil while stirring continuously. Allow it to simmer for about 2 minutes to thicken slightly. Step 2: Add the SpiritsRemove the saucepan from the heat and let the cocoa mixture cool for a few minutes.Slowly pour in the vodka (or your chosen spirit) while stirring continuously to combine. Step 3: Creamy PerfectionStir in the heavy cream,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t, blending everything until the mixture is velvety and smooth. Step 4: Bottle & StoreUsing a funnel, carefully pour the freshly made Chocolate Liqueur into a glass bottle or container of your choice.Seal the bottle tightly and store it in the refrigerator for up to a month. Though, with its irresistible taste, it's unlikely to last that long!
